Menturio/WEB 1.6 released
This release (a.k.a. “Babel Fish”) focuses on the single most important thing in web development, browser compatibility. Naturally it includes several other new and improved features:

Browser compatibility
Alternative browsers (Mozilla Firefox being the most popular of them at the current time) becoming more and more widespread, it is necessary for any web-based service to support as many as possible. With browser implementations being so different it is virtually impossible for large systems to be completely browser independent. Considering current browser usage studies, we have concentrated our efforts to make our first step in browser independence: Mozilla Firefox compatibility.

Project independency
Testing Menturio™ we have noticed that project dependency sometimes decreases effectiveness. One of the best examples is when you open an item by entering its identifier: if the desired item is not in the current project, you cannot use this method. This presents a problem when you only have the identifier of the item and no other information. Keeping this in mind we have developed project independency for the following features:
- open item by identifier
- manage items
- edit items

Improved e-mail sending
Sending e-mail notifications about issues is considered by our partners one of the most useful features of Menturio™. Following polls we have introduced several new features for issue e-mail notification. We have introduced improved recipient selection with the address list comprised of available Menturio™ users; from now on, selecting recipients is as easy as in any e-mail client application. Using another new feature you can append additional notes to the e-mail and at the same time, add the notes to Menturio™ as well.
